So far I enjoy working with MochiKit very much. Per Cederberg wrote: > Actually, I don't think it is possible (from reading only the > documentation). The log filtering is only applied to listeners. But > even they cannot affect what is being sent to the native console. > > I think you'd have to assign some of the log* methods to > MochiKit.Base.noop in order to silence their log messages. Or replace > the default logger with your own. > > Now, I'm planning to revamp the logging sometime to alleviate issues > like this. While not breaking backwards compability I hope.
